Belted Galloways have thrived at Edelweiss Ranch since their introduction in 2006. The herd enjoys lush meadows and a sparkling creek that feeds the nearby Clarrie Hall Dam.
Peter and Sue Ellen have found the naturally calm nature of the breed to be a delight. They respond positively to daily human interactions on the ranch, and are sweet tempered and affectionate.
Herd numbers average between 60 – 70, which given the size of the property (close to 70 acres) is a testament to the exceptional quality of the Edelweiss pastures. The herd currently comprises one bull, around 30 cows and 35+ calves and yearlings.
